Few car audio devices in recent years have sparked as much online collaboration—and frustration—as the 7010B radio. For countless drivers worldwide, a seemingly generic 7-inch double‑DIN unit, often rebranded under names like UNITOPSCI, Podofo, Camecho, and SUOKULA, has become a daily companion. Yet, beneath that functional touchscreen and Bluetooth connectivity lies a fragile ecosystem: firmware that manufacturers treat as an afterthought, leaving owners in a labyrinth of incompatible files, bricked hardware, and cryptic forum posts. 7010b radio firmware update exclusive
